What Are They Gambling On?
When you break down the money swirling around, it’s a clear reflection of the chaos surrounding Trump. Over $1 million is already riding on tracking specific words he might utter. Here’s the current hot list:
- “America” at a staggering 95%—that’s practically a lock.
- “Israel” or “Gaza” almost at the same certainty (93%).
- “AI” getting a nod twice has traders hopeful, sitting at 77%.
- “Jobs” could hit 20 mentions at a solid 69%.

Name-Dropping Madness
They are also wagering big time on who makes it into his conversation. Biden leads at a whopping 95%. It’s no surprise he's in the crosshairs, but check this out:
- Maduro at 88%—still keeping that geopolitical finger on the pulse.
- Charlie Kirk brings in 55%—that could sway the younger base.
- And my favorite, President Xi at 59%. The implications here could shake investor confidence and add fuel to that fire under U.S.-China tensions.
However, let’s keep an eye on Putin—sitting at 49%. If he gets a mention, expect that to reverberate across markets. But here’s a kicker: the mention of Elon Musk barely breaks the surface at 22%. Their friendship turned sour, and it seems traders are cautious on any shoutouts.
Side Bets and Market Speculation
Now, if you think that’s it, hold your horses. The speech length is a whole other betting spectrum. With $280,000 down, traders are guessing at a long-winded affair, with over 100 minutes currently leading at 48%. However, if history is any indication, previous SOTUs from Trump came in under 100 minutes—so keep that in your back pocket.
